Understanding Demand Fluctuations
What are Demand Fluctuations?
Demand fluctuations refer to the variations in consumer demand for products or services over time. These fluctuations can be influenced by numerous factors, including seasonality, economic conditions, and changes in consumer preferences. Understanding these dynamics is crucial for businesses aiming to optimize their inventory and pricing strategies. He must take apart historical data to identify patterns.
In the context of skin care, demand fluctuations can be particularly pronounced due to seasonal changes and emerging trends. For instance, during summer months, consumers may seek lighter formulations, while winter often drives demand for more hydrating products. This seasonal behavior can significantly impact sales forecasts. It is essential to stay informed about these trends.
Moreover, external factors such as economic downturns or shifts in consumer spending power can lead to sudden changes in demand. A decrease in disposable income may result in consumers prioritizing essential products over luxury items. He should monitor economic indicators closely.
Additionally, the rise of social media and influencer marketing has created new demand patterns. Consumers are increasingly influenced by online reviews and recommendations, leading to rapid shifts in product popularity. This phenomenon underscores the importance of agile marketing strategies. Adapting quickly is vital for success.
By comprehensively analyzing these demand fluctuations, businesses can make informed decisions that enhance their competitive edge. He must leverage data analytics to forecast demand accurately. Understanding these fluctuations is not just beneficial; it is essential for sustained growth in a competitive market.

Market Research Methods
Market research methods are essential for understanding consumer behavior and preferences, particularly in the skincare industry. Various tools and techniques can be employed to conduct demand analysis effectively. Surveys and questionnaires are commonly used to gather quantitative data from potential customers. These instruments allow for the collection of specific information regarding consumer needs and preferences. They can be easily distributed online, reaching a broad audience quickly. This method provides valuable insights into market trends.
Focus groups are another effective technique for demand analysis. By engaging a little group of participants in discussions, researchers can gain qualitative insights into consumer attitudes and perceptions. This approach allows for deeper exploration of motivations behind purchasing decisions. It can reveal nuances that surveys might overlook. Understanding these subtleties is crucial for developing targeted marketing strategies.
Additionally, observational research can be employed to analyze consumer behavior in real-time. By observing how individuals interact with skincare products in retail environments, researchers can identify patterns and preferences. This method provides a practical perspective on consumer choices. It often uncovers insights that are not readily available through self-reported data. Observational research can be time-consuming but is often worth the investment.
